What they do

A Neurologist diagnoses and treats patients with disorders or injuries related to the central nervous system or the brain. Provides medical care to patients recovering from strokes or with illnesses such as dementia; may treat patients for nerve damage or spinal cord injury. Works from a private practice or within a hospital or larger healthcare facility.
